Pension Fund Committee - Friday, 23rd January, 2026 2.00 pm
The Pension Fund Committee of Lancashire County Council met on Friday, 23rd January 2026, to discuss key parameters for the 2025 valuation of the pension fund. The committee ultimately resolved to approve a funding strategy statement with a 115% funding buffer and a 20-year recovery period, resulting in a provisional average employer contribution rate of 9.1%.

Pension Fund Committee - Friday, 12th December, 2025 10.30 am
The Lancashire County Council Pension Fund Committee was scheduled to meet on 12 December 2025 to discuss pension-related training for committee members, budget monitoring for the 2025/26 financial year, and responsible investment activity. Also on the agenda was an update on the Funding Strategy Statement consultation, and the Local Pensions Partnership Annual Report and Accounts for 2024/25. Some items, including updates on the Lancashire County Pension Fund (LCPF) Strategic Plan 2024/25, Local Pensions Partnership Administration (LPPA), risk register, shareholder and investment performance, and the appointment of an independent investment advisor, were scheduled to be discussed in Part II of the meeting, which was not open to the press or public.
